Yeah, all of this seems like guesswork and stuff that has already been confirmed (or not confirmed, in the case of Zendaya being MJ).

But here's another thing to consider: even if these leaks are real, there is a good chance everything about them could change. Apparently, there were leaks for Age of Ultron about Loki's involvement in the movie and how they said that Loki controlled Ultron — which was a misconception the audience had and the reason Loki's dream sequence was cut from the film.

Most of the things leaked are from movies that don't even have final scripts yet, so again, even if the leaks were real, odds are that most of the things they said are going to change due to different drafts, directors wanting to do something else, or just things being different.

Also the big thing that causes this to fall apart is actually small. They say Marvel and Fox have improved relations and there will be an FF reboot in the MCU, with the evidence being that Marvel allowed Fox to use the Helicarrier in Deadpool.

Word of God from the people who actually made Deadpool is that it was a Lawyer-Friendly Cameo, which was why they never called it a Helicarrier onscreen and why they requested that the concept artist not make it look like the ones from Winter Soldier or The Avengers.
